complexType FaultParamType
diagram
namespace http://mastar.ucs.indiana.edu/fault
children value error constrained
used by
elements LocationType/Depth CartViewType/DipAngle FaultDimensionType/Length FaultDimensionType/Width
annotation
documentation 

This type is used to hold both the value and the error.
Error is optional. Constrained means the value maybe described as fixed or allowed to change (which is used by simplex).    
source
<complexType name="FaultParamType">
  <annotation>
    <documentation>
This type is used to hold both the value and the error.
Error is optional. Constrained means the value maybe described as fixed or allowed to change (which is used by simplex).    </documentation>
  </annotation>
  <sequence>
    <element name="value" type="gml:MeasureType"/>
    <element name="error" type="gml:MeasureType" default="0.0" minOccurs="0"/>
    <element name="constrained" type="boolean" default="true" minOccurs="0"/>
  </sequence>
</complexType>
